Round cutting blades are an additional core category made use of throughout industrial processing. A circular slitter blade, circular blade for slitting, circular knives, and round blades are typically utilized in transforming, textile, paper, film, aluminum foil, and various other web-processing procedures. The design of circular cutting tools permits constant rotating motion, which supports high-speed cutting with minimized rubbing and improved accuracy. In slitting applications, the blade needs to generate clean edges while reducing burrs, contortion, or product distortion. As a result of the selection of materials processed on contemporary lines, circular slitting devices are offered in several measurements, side geometries, and alloys. Picking the correct circular slitter blade can have a major impact on cut high quality, device life, and total production efficiency, especially in operations where even slight edge flaws can trigger downstream issues.
Roll shear knives are likewise important in industrial cutting systems where precise shearing activity is required. Unlike blades made for basic slicing, roll shear knives are often constructed for specialized machinery that requires regulated pressure and repeatable edge involvement. These knives should stand up to mechanical tension while keeping precise alignment and intensity across extended usage. In packaging, paper, film, and web-handling settings, roll shear knives help develop clean, regular cuts that support downstream converting and finishing processes. Their efficiency depends on metallurgy, warmth treatment, edge geometry, and machine compatibility, making them a vital part of any kind of well-maintained manufacturing system. When a company makes use of high-performance roll shear knives, it can typically lower material waste and boost output high quality without raising machine complexity.

The recycling industry places especially high demands on cutting tools, and plastic shredder blade, plastic crusher blade, plastic recycling blades, industry shredder blades, and industry granulator blades are all component of that environment. Plastic shredder blades are commonly charged with tearing through bulky products, while plastic crusher blades assist minimize waste into smaller sized pieces that can be more refined. Industry shredder blades and industry granulator blades are engineered to work under hefty tons, typically in continuous-duty atmospheres where downtime is costly.
Guillotine shearing blades stand for one more specialized category made use of in applications where effective straight-line cutting is required. These blades are typically made use of in machinery made for durable shearing of sheet materials, steels, plastics, or other industrial items. Their performance depends on intensity, edge stamina, and the ability to keep a right, tidy cut under considerable pressure. In lots of operations, guillotine shearing blades are chosen because they can manage requiring products while protecting reduced high quality and minimizing deformation. The exact demands differ by industry, however the value of accuracy continues to be continuous. A high-quality shearing blade can minimize rework, boost security, and sustain a lot more effective production cycles.

Blade upkeep is another significant consider making best use of value from industrial cutting devices. Also the very best vent cutter, packaging knife, circular slitter blade, or plastic crusher blade will underperform if it is not correctly kept. Regular evaluation, developing, alignment checks, and appropriate setup are all essential to preserve cutting high quality. Boring blades can raise rubbing, raise energy use, damages products, and create security dangers. In food processing, a used poultry blade can influence health and output consistency. In packaging, a damaged circular blade for slitting can create bad edge high quality and waste. In recycling, used shredder blades can minimize throughput and area excess pressure on equipment. A self-displined upkeep strategy helps preserve blade life and makes sure the devices proceeds running effectively.
